Ticket: Staging env misconfigured for Siftgate bloom filter

The bloom layer in front of the Pellet KV store is rejecting all lookups in staging because the env file was copied from the dev template without credentials. False-positive tuning values are fine; only the auth line is missing. To unblock the weekly demo, the Pellet admission secret must be set on the following line.

env line for yaguf-fajop: LEDGER_TOKEN13=fb08984397349

Subject: Quickstore 4.2 — bloom filter now fronts the KV layer

Plugin authors: starting with this release, Quickstore places a bloom filter ahead of the key-value store. Negative lookups return faster; false positives fall through safely. No API changes are required on your side. Verify your plugin against the staging build referenced below.

session token of fahif-tadup = htk3_9c7

// REINDEX_BATCH_CAP limits docs per shard pass in the Tallowfield
// nightly search reindex. Raising it starves the ingest queue;
// lowering it overruns the maintenance window. 5000 is the tested
// sweet spot. Change only with a soak run. Verified against the
// build noted below.

session token of bawif-hahog = htk6_ac5981

Dark mode in the Plover admin dashboard is officially on for this release. Plugin authors: please stop hardcoding hex backgrounds — use the theme tokens we ship in the Plover UI kit, or your panels will look like a flashlight in a cave. We've verified all first-party widgets against both palettes. Before you publish, confirm your plugin renders cleanly in the staging build tagged with the identifier below.

pipeline stamp: htk14_378fd70323001d